1. Linen Stitch (Also known as Granite or Moss Stitch): The linen stitch is a beloved classic in the crochet community, admired for its elegant simplicity and knitted appearance. Combining single crochet and chain stitches, it produces a dense, closed texture that's flexible vertically but not so much horizontally. Ideal for blankets, scarves, and bags, this stitch pattern adds a touch of sophistication to any project.

To create the linen stitch, start with an odd number of chains and alternate between single crochet and chain stitches in each row. This stitch pattern is known for its versatility and can be used in various projects, including the Bradley Afghan, Odyssey Wrap, or Patchwork Cardi.

Alpine Stitch (Or Alpine Tree Stitch): Named after the alpine mountain range and its resemblance to the trees that adorn these majestic landscapes, the alpine stitch is a captivating combination of double crochet and treble crochet stitches. The treble crochets are worked around the post of stitches from a few rows below, resulting in a beautifully textured fabric that remains lightweight.

Begin with an odd number of chains and alternate between rows of double crochet and single crochet stitches. This stitch pattern's rhythmic flow will quickly become your favorite, and you'll adore crafting projects such as cozy blankets, stylish wraps, and intricate cardigans with it.

3. Waffle Stitch: The waffle stitch is renowned for its thick, plush texture, making it perfect for creating warm and cozy items like scarves, blankets, and even dishcloths. This pattern uses front post double crochets and back post double crochets to create raised, textured squares that resemble a waffle's delightful pattern.

Start with a multiple of three chains plus an additional two, and then alternate between rows of front post double crochets and back post double crochets. The waffle stitch is not only visually appealing but also provides excellent insulation, making it an excellent choice for cold-weather accessories.

4. V-Stitch: The V-stitch is a versatile and openwork pattern that consists of double crochets separated by a chain stitch, forming a «V» shape. This pattern is incredibly adaptable and can be adjusted for various purposes, from lacy shawls and lightweight tops to baby blankets and afghans.

Begin with a foundation chain, and then work double crochets and chain stitches to create the elegant V-stitch pattern. Its simplicity and elegance make it a go-to choice for both beginners and experienced crocheters, offering endless design possibilities.

5. Granny Square: No list of classic crochet stitch patterns would be complete without the iconic granny square. With its timeless charm and versatility, the granny square has been a favorite among crocheters for generations. Whether you're making vintage-style blankets, boho-chic garments, or colorful home decor, the granny square is a must-have in your repertoire.

Start with a small square at the center and build outward by working clusters of double crochets and chain spaces. Combine various colors and textures to create unique and eye-catching designs. The granny square's adaptability and timeless appeal ensure its place in the hearts of crocheters worldwide.
